Reaves' Impact on the Lakers
Austin Reaves has quickly become a fan favorite and a crucial part of the Los Angeles Lakers. His journey from an undrafted free agent to a key player is nothing short of remarkable. Reaves brings a unique blend of basketball IQ, shooting ability, and playmaking that complements the Lakers' star-studded lineup. His ability to read the game and make smart decisions on both ends of the court has earned him the trust of his teammates and coaches alike. Defensively, Reaves is known for his tenacity and willingness to take charges, often disrupting the opponent's offensive flow. His impact extends beyond the box score, as he provides a spark and energy that elevates the team's performance. Whether he's knocking down clutch shots, creating opportunities for others, or making hustle plays, Reaves consistently finds ways to contribute to the Lakers' success. His presence on the court provides a sense of stability and reliability, making him an indispensable asset for the team's championship aspirations. As he continues to develop and refine his skills, Reaves has the potential to become an even more integral part of the Lakers' future.
